1. Diagnose the Problem: The first and most crucial step is to find out *why* the light is on. You have several options:
* OBD-II Scanner: This is the best method. An OBD-II scanner (available relatively cheaply at auto parts stores) will read the diagnostic trouble codes (DTCs). These codes pinpoint the specific problem the computer has detected. You can then look up the code online to understand the issue.
* Auto Parts Store: Many auto parts stores offer free code reading services. They can tell you what the code means and potentially suggest solutions.
* Mechanic: If you're uncomfortable diagnosing the problem yourself, take it to a qualified mechanic.
2. Fix the Problem: Once you know the DTC, address the underlying issue. This might involve replacing a faulty sensor, fixing a leak, or performing other repairs.
3. Clear the Code (After Repair): *Only after you've fixed the problem* can you clear the code. There are several ways to do this:
* OBD-II Scanner: Most scanners have a function to clear the diagnostic trouble codes.
* Disconnect the Battery: This is a less reliable method. Disconnect the negative (-) battery terminal for about 15-20 minutes. This will often reset the computer, but it's not guaranteed to clear all codes. Reconnect the battery and start the vehicle. The light may take a few drive cycles to turn off if the problem is truly resolved.
Important Considerations:
* Driving with the light on: Ignoring the check engine light is not recommended. The problem could worsen, leading to more expensive repairs or even safety hazards.
* Intermittent Problems: Sometimes, a problem causing the check engine light might be intermittent. Even if you clear the code, it might return if the underlying issue isn't fixed.
In short, focus on fixing the problem, not just resetting the light. Using an OBD-II scanner is strongly recommended for proper diagnosis.
